@sandray7609 Animals that we eat don't eat the same plants that we eat at least not naturally. All the land and grass that cows would use naturally can offset their carbon footprint, it can actually offset the carbon of the entire farm. Again, it's not like this country wasn't full of millions of large animals that produced methane in the past. It also has numerous other benefits for soil health. It would be more expensive and burgers would no longer be cheap, but it would far better for the planet, our health, and the cows if they were raised in an actual sustainable manner.
A lot of meats aren't "conventional" (insects, deer, many other small animals, etc.). However we've created entire industries around specific kinds of animals and plants since those industries are profitable. Even when we go to plant based foods they largely try to mimic meats (burgers, turkey, bacon, etc.) that we're already accustomed to. Instead of adapting our diets to a natural ecosystem we decided to industrialize everything to suit what we wanted instead. Many Native American societies learned how to coexist with the environment, we haven't.
Keep in mind that you cannot grow most plants that we eat without animals, there is a balance there. The only reason we can is because we rely on fossil fuels in the form of petrochemicals for fertilizers and pesticides to replace what would happen naturally.
